html-1

html是什么
1.html是一种超文本标记语言,只要用于网页制作,可以在网页上显示文字,图像,视频,声音等。
2.html只能做静态网页,不能用于做动态网页
静态网页(html)
动态网页(php/jsp/asp/asp.net/cgi)
动态网页示意图:

html-1

html基本结构
<html>
<head></head>
<body>
<元素 属性1 = ”属性值”属性2 = “属性值”....... >内容</元素>
<元素 属性=“属性值/>
</body>
</html>
html-1

注:标签通常成对出现也有单标记如</br>


html运行原理
html运行有两种方式
1.本地运行(直接用本地浏览器运行)
html-1

2.远程访问(服务器)
html 需要安装apache服务器 
本地访问:http://localhost/html文件名(html要放在服务器特定目录)
远程访问:http://ip地址//html文件名

远程访问示意图:
html-1

何为协议?
计算机互相通信的规则如ftp,pop,http等

html开发工具
editpluse   vim   zend studio

案例1
<html>
<head></head>
<body>
<b>横看成岭侧成峰</b><br/>
<font color="red">远近高低尽不同</font><br/>
<font size="7">不识庐山真面目</font></br></br>
<font>只缘身在此山中</font>
</body>
</html>
html-1

面试题:请问后缀html和htm有什么区别?

答:1.如果一个网站有index html和index htm默认情况下,优先访问.html

         2.htm后缀是为了兼容以前的dos系统8.3的命名规范